Canon Digital Camera SX710
3 of 3 found this helpful easy to use in auto mode; automatically adjusts mode between closeups, portraits, scenery, etc. WiFi image transfer works well with PC and Android devices; not so good with smart TV. good telephoto, but hard to hold steady at greater than about 10X (get a tripod). Lens cover flimsy and could be damaged when the camera is stuffed in a pocket. function dials and buttons are small and hard to read or adjust, but most users will leave the camera set to auto. battery must be removed from the camera for charging. no internal memory therefore an SD card is required. no cords supplied for A/V or HDMI connections, but most have a few of these laying about. a mini HDMI to HDMI cable is needed to connect to TV. good size and weight to slip into a pocket, but watch that lens cover.
